NetApp, Inc. is seeking a Commercial Client Executive to manage sales activities in designated Commercial accounts across the UK and Ireland. You will play a crucial role in building relationships with customers and partners while coordinating with various sales and pre-sales teams.
The ideal candidate will have a proven track record in driving net new business, a solid understanding of modern computing technologies, and the ability to meet sales quotas. A Bachelor's degree or equivalent is required.
This position supports a hybrid work environment, promoting connection and collaboration among employees.

How to prepare for a job interview at NetApp, Inc.
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on modern computing technologies relevant to the role. Understand NetApp's products and services inside out, as well as the competitive landscape.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the company.
✨Showcase Your Sales Success
Prepare specific examples of how you've driven net new business in your previous roles.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ers. This will demonstrate your ability to meet sales quotas and highlight your strategic thinking.
✨Build Rapport
Since this role involves building relationships with customers and partners, practice your interpersonal skills. Be friendly and approachable during the interview. Ask insightful questions about the team dynamics and company culture to show that you value collaboration.
